Opening: A Renaissance masterpiece

On 18 December 1984 the Castello di Rivoli Museum of Contemporary Art was inaugurated on the initiative of the Piedmont Region and thanks to the restoration of the architect Andrea Bruno. To celebrate the Museum's birthday, Christmas and the return of important sculptures belonging to the historical heritage of the Savoy Residence, on Saturday 18 December at 11 the Director, Carolyn Christov-Bakargiev, and the Mayor of the City of Rivoli, Andrea Tragaioli, will welcome the visitors in Room 15 so-called 'of the Four Continents' where the wooden Juvarra model will also be presented, which on this occasion returns to the venue illuminated by the contemporary artist Renato Leotta, as well as the sixteenth-century masterpiece of France, Madonna with Child and an angel who presents San Giovanni Battista, from the Cerruti Collection.
